A decomposition approach for facility location and relocation problem with uncertain number of future facilities
Authors:Ayse Durukan Sonmez Gino J Lim
Institution:Department of Industrial Engineering, University of Houston, 4800 Calhoun Road, Houston, TX 77204, United States
Abstract:In this paper, we discuss two challenges of long term facility location problem that occur simultaneously; future demand change and uncertain number of future facilities. We introduce a mathematical model that minimizes the initial and expected future weighted travel distance of customers. Our model allows relocation for the future instances by closing some of the facilities that were located initially and opening new ones, without exceeding a given budget. We present an integer programming formulation of the problem and develop a decomposition algorithm that can produce near optimal solutions in a fast manner. We compare the performance of our mathematical model against another method adapted from the literature and perform sensitivity analysis. We present numerical results that compare the performance of the proposed decomposition algorithm against the exact algorithm for the problem.
Keywords:Facility location  Uncertainty  p-Median
